Holy Ghost

Christ Talking to his apostles prior to his death on the cross.

John 16: 12-15

016:012 I have yet many things to say unto you, but ye cannot bear them now.

016:013 Howbeit when he, the Spirit of truth, is come, he will guide you into all truth: for he shall not speak of himself; but whatsoever he shall hear, that shall he speak: and he will shew you things to come.

016:014 He shall glorify me: for he shall receive of mine, and shall shew it unto you.

016:015 All things that the Father hath are mine: therefore said I, that he shall take of mine, and shall shew it unto you.

Christ talking to the apostles after he arose and before he went into heaven.

Acts 1: 6-9

001:006 When they therefore were come together, they asked of him, saying, Lord, wilt thou at this time restore again the kingdom to Israel?

001:007 And he said unto them, It is not for you to know the times or the seasons, which the Father hath put in his own power.

001:008 But ye shall receive power, after that the Holy Ghost is come upon you: and ye shall be witnesses unto me both in Jerusalem, and in all Judaea, and in Samaria, and unto the uttermost part of the earth.

001:009 And when he had spoken these things, while they beheld, he was taken up; and a cloud received him out of their sight.

This the time when the apostles received the Gift of the Holy Ghost that Jesus had promised them.

This gift was different than the one we receive after we are baptised.  This allowed them to KNOW Jesus' Words to say and to do miracles.

Acts 2:1-4

002:001 And when the day of Pentecost was fully come, they were all with one accord in one place.

002:002 And suddenly there came a sound from heaven as of a rushing mighty wind, and it filled all the house where they were sitting.

002:003 And there appeared unto them cloven tongues like as of fire, and it sat upon each of them.

002:004 And they were all filled with the Holy Ghost, and began to speak with other tongues, as the Spirit gave them utterance.
